Longtime viewers of “Power” are understandably disappointed that season six will be the show’s final season. These same viewers, though, no it is ending at the right time. So much has happened that now the show has to end.
Several times over, Ghost (Omari Hardwick) has broken up with Tasha and Angela (Naturi Naughton, Lela Loren) for the other. Also, he and Tommy (Joseph Sikora) have turned on each other several times. The only thing left to do is handle Dre (Rotimi) since Kanan (50 Cent) died.
Yesterday, Courtney Kemp announced Mary J. Blige will star in the sequel series. Season six will be broken into two parts, a ten episode “Book I,” which begins on August 25. Then, there is the “Book II: Ghost,” where Mary J. Blige will star, following her “My Life” episode on “Tales,” starring Grace Byers.
